caesium
Plural: caesiums
Noun
- A soft, silvery-gold metallic element, highly reactive.
- a soft silver-white ductile metallic element (liquid at normal temperatures); the most electropositive and alkaline metal
- The chemical element (symbol Cs) with an atomic number of 55. It is a soft, gold-colored, highly reactive alkali metal.

Origin / Etymology
From Latin caesius (“sky-blue”), in reference to the radiation spectra, + -ium.
Synonyms
atomic number 55, cesium, Cs
